The cost to install a walk-in shower varies based on size, materials, and existing bathroom conditions in [city]. Licensed, insured pros will provide a precise estimate after assessing your specific needs and the scope of work required.
Common issues can include improper sealing leading to leaks, inadequate drainage, or accessibility challenges if not installed correctly. Choosing licensed and certified installers in [city] helps prevent these problems by ensuring proper setup and quality materials.
Medicare typically covers medical equipment and services deemed medically necessary. While they may not directly pay for a standard walk-in shower installation, they might cover specific adaptive equipment or modifications if prescribed by a doctor for specific health needs in [city].
The best type often depends on individual needs. Features like low thresholds, built-in seats, grab bars, and non-slip flooring are crucial for safety and comfort in [city] homes. A professional assessment will help determine the ideal configuration for you.
Disadvantages can include the initial cost of installation and potential water usage. However, for many in [city], the increased safety, independence, and ease of cleaning far outweigh these considerations, especially when professionally installed.
For seniors in [city], the ideal walk-in shower prioritizes safety and ease of use. Look for a curbless entry, ample space for mobility aids, sturdy grab bars, a comfortable built-in seat, and good lighting. A local pro can customize these features.
